JNA Jewellery Design Competition 2018/19 reveals panel of judges

Judges of the competition's inaugural edition have been chosen for their extensive knowledge and design expertise. They will evaluate entries on their adherence to the theme, originality, creativity, aesthetics and market potential.

The independent judging panel is chaired by renowned jewellery designer Fei Liu who earned the coveted UKJA Designer of the Year award in 2016 and was named Designer of the Year by China's Harper Bazaar in 2012. Liu founded his eponymous brand in 2006, creating pieces with East-meets-West influences. His jewellery is sold in over 155 boutiques around the world, including the UK, Germany and China .

Liu is joined on the panel of judges by Bradley Theodore , the famous New York -based visual artist; Robert Tateossian , the founder of the Tateossian London brand; Christie Dang , the Publisher and Editor-in-Chief of the JNA group of publications; and an illustrious market insider from each category.

Born in Turks & Caicos, New York City -based Bradley Theodore is a multi-disciplinary artist known for his murals depicting contemporary pop culture and fashion "royalty" in his signature skeletal style. His works include distinctive, colourful portraits of Queen Elizabeth , George Washington and fashion giants Anna Wintour and Karl Lagerfeld .

Widely recognised as the 'King of Cufflinks,' Robert Tateossian founded his eponymous brand in 1990. The Tateossian brand has won the UK British Export Award for Accessories three times. Many of its signature elements reflect Robert's own appreciation of mechanism, aesthetics and the unconventional, delivering distinctive yet wearable pieces.

Christie Dang has travelled the world to report on the latest and most pressing developments in the gemstone and jewellery trade. For more than 20 years, she has lead CJNA, one of the most influential jewellery publications in the Greater China region. In August 2017 , she became Publisher and Editor-in-Chief of the JNA group of publications.

Ida Wong is the General Manager of the Tahitian Pearl Association Hong Kong (TPAHK). She has been actively promoting Tahitian pearls by initiating sponsorships and other marketing campaigns, thereby contributing to greater awareness of the gem among designers, wholesalers, retailers and consumers.

Hidetaka Dobashi established Crossfor Co Ltd in 1999. Two years later, he obtained the patent for the Crossfor Cut technique. In 2011, Crossfor launched the patented "Dancing Stone" mechanism that sets a centre stone in constant motion. The company was listed on the Tokyo Stock Exchange (JASDAQ) in 2017.

Suzanne Wong , Senior Product Manager of Platinum Guild International, is committed to developing innovative jewellery designs in platinum. With over 25 years of experience in the jewellery industry, working with renowned jewellery brands and leading retailers in China , she is an expert on design, R&D and market strategy.

The judges will first select 15 finalists, who will be announced in the middle of January 2019 . For more details, see http://www.jnadesigncompetition.com/
